The Evolution of Shipping Container Transport
The concept of shipping products in containers dates back to the 1950s. Before the prevalent adoption of containers, products were loaded and unloaded from ships in a labor-intensive process that made transportation sluggish and cumbersome. Malcom McLean, a trucking business owner, is credited with pioneering the usage of standardized shipping containers, which enabled intermodal transport-- moving cargo effectively throughout various transport modes, such as trucks and trains.

The shipping container transport procedure includes a number of stages:

Container Loading: Containers are packed at the maker’s facility, frequently using cranes and other machinery to ensure quick operation.

Transport to Port: Loaded containers are carried by means of trucks or trains to the nearby shipping port.

Customs Clearance: Before containers can be packed onto vessels, they should pass through custom-mades, where they are checked, and duties are assessed.

Vessel Loading: Once cleared, containers are loaded onto cargo ships, frequently using specialized cranes.

Ocean Transport: Containers are carried throughout oceans to their location ports.

Port Handling: Upon arrival at the destination port, containers are unloaded and transported to their final location, often via trucks or trains.

Shipping container transport has a number of advantages that make it essential for modern-day trade:
1. Effectiveness:
Containerization lowers dealing with time, enabling faster loading and dumping, which speeds up overall transit times.
2. Cost-Effectiveness:
By consolidating items into a single container, shippers can make the most of economies of scale, reducing shipping expenses per system.
3. Security:
Containers offer a protected method to transport goods, decreasing theft and damage during transit.
4. Intermodal Flexibility:
Shipping containers can be easily transferred in between ships, trucks, and trains, assisting in seamless transportation throughout multiple modes.
5. Standardization:
Uniform container sizes simplify loading and unloading procedures, decreasing time and labor costs.
Difficulties in Shipping Container Transport
In spite of its many advantages, shipping container transport deals with some difficulties, consisting of:
1. Port Congestion:
Busy ports can result in delays in loading and dumping treatments.
2. Customs Compliance:
Navigating complicated customizeds guidelines can make complex shipping schedules.
3. Ecological Impact:
While shipping is generally more effective than other kinds of transportation, it still adds to carbon emissions.
4. Supply Chain Disruptions:
Global events, such as pandemics or geopolitical tensions, can interrupt shipping paths and schedules.

3. What is a TEU?
A Twenty-foot Equivalent Unit (TEU) is a standard measurement used in the shipping industry to quantify cargo capacity. One TEU is comparable to a basic 20-foot shipping container.
